Finished installing, will say a bit about it once I'm in the actual game though I'm fairly bad at RTS titles but it's worth a try atleast. Razz

EDIT: Uses PhysX by the way, probably no GPU accelerated effects though.

EDIT: Various images from the intro videos, introduction video and tutorial area, pretty well optimized but I'm only beginning to learn about the various gameplay mechanics and systems feels sort of similar to the "Creative Asembly" total war titles in a way or the Crusader title released a while ago though a bit more focused on the campaign and story.
(Although skirmish maps and MP is available as well.)




EDIT: Battles are more about using proper strategy as they are quite difficult to win at the early stages of the game since you don't really have a proper army, only won the first battle due to the "knight" taking on the remaining enemy soldiers alone and won.
(They're not that well animated either so speeding up time after arranging troops and giving orders helps quite a bit, probably don't want to use the auto-resolve button to avoid losing too many troops, also there's no retreat or morale as I've seen so it's a battle to the death with every enemy unit until they are all dead.)





(Was mostly fooling around as it's kinda a tutorial for the battle mechanics of the game, terrain type, formations and movement speed is very important, as is various abilities and of course your units and the enemy units both their strength and type such as light, heavy, melee or ranged or riders.)

EDIT: As seen with the map screens the game world is quite big even for this first chapter (Of three.) and there's a lot of little details like the description for the various areas and you also have a form of journal to track progress and read more about the background story and various characters.

EDIT: One thing though, voice acting can take some time to get used to, heh.
(Outro video also seems to point towards a expansion later on.)
